Output ecdab21858244a7d0e20b940613648bc7c7e02459eb845948609628624c09d86:592

value
16424
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d591f4f8106442e54ad73496306bc79342035311157c9fcde02abed227a46b9
address
bc1ph4v37nupqezzu49dwdykxp4u0y6zqdf3z9tunlx7q2476gn6g6usg4a5za
transaction
ecdab21858244a7d0e20b940613648bc7c7e02459eb845948609628624c09d86